CITATION : Skalkos v Smiles & Ors [2003] NSWSC 101 HEARING DATE(S) : 26 February 2003 JUDGMENT DATE : 26 February 2003 JURISDICTION: Common Law Division JUDGMENT OF : Master Malpass DECISION : I confirm the decision and dismiss the present application. Kotsakis is to pay the costs of the Notice of Motion filed on 15 October 2002. The Exhibit may be returned.
CATCHWORDS : Review - discretionary power - relevant considerations. LEGISLATION CITED : Bankruptcy Act 1966, s 82, Pt X.
